Geological Characteristics and Genesis of the Nanlao Cu-W Deposit in Laojunshan Area, Southeastern Yunnan Province |
The Nanlao Cu-W deposit, a newly-discovered ore deposit, is located in the northwestern periphery of the Laojunshan granite body. Its proved Cu and W reserves have reached the middle scale, as evidenced by recent exploration. The Cu and W mineralization occurs near the interbedded detachment faults between Xinzhai Formation and Nanlao gneiss. The ore bodies are mainly hosted in the wall rocks which experienced alterations such as silicification and skarnization. The geological and geochemical characteristics of the ore deposit suggest that the mineralization of the ore deposit was mainly controlled by Yanshanian granites, strata and detachment faults, and the ore-forming materials might have been mainly derived from Yanshanian and Caledonian granites. It is held that the formation of this ore deposit was related to the multiphase tectonism-magmatism. In addition, the ore-prospecting direction in Laojunshan area is pointed out in this paper. |
